Phillip Rios Arrested after Lubbock Car Crash at 19th Street and Slide Road
Lubbock, Texas (May 31, 2019) – The hit-and-run driver who caused a traffic accident that injured one person early this month in Lubbock has been arrested, authorities said.
The crash happened just after 2:00 a.m. Friday, May 3 at the intersection of 19th Street and Slide Road.
According to reports, a  black Nissan Altima drive by Aaron Weseman, 21, was heading eastbound on 19th Street across the intersection when it was struck by a white Lincoln LS driven by Phillip Rios, 38.
Rios did not stop to render aid to the victim and fled the scene. Weseman was taken by responding paramedics to Covenant Health with unspecified injuries.
Rios was arrested on Tuesday, May 28, for hit-and-run causing bodily injury.
The crash remains under investigation.
